How to implement paging display in thinkphp
ThinkPHP is an open source framework based on PHP and is widely used in web development. In the actual development process, the paging function is often used. This article will introduce how to use the paging function in ThinkPHP.
Ideas and steps:
ThinkPHP uses the Bootstrap style by default, and the paging function is implemented through the paginate method in TP. The paginate method inherits the paging class TP\paginate and returns the paging string. The paging string includes paging navigation, paging results and other information. The following are the specific implementation steps of paging:
Step 1: Install the TP extension class (TP comes with the paging class).
composer require topthink/think-pagination
Step 2: Set paging parameters in the controller.
$page = input('page') ?: 1; //获取页码数,默认为第一页 $limit = 10; //每页显示记录数 $start = ($page - 1) * $limit; //起始记录索引,例如:第一页 $start=0,第二页 $start=10... $list = Db::name('user')->limit($start, $limit)->select(); $count = Db::name('user')->count(); // 获取总记录数 $this->assign([ 'list' => $list, 'count' => $count, 'limit' => $limit ]);
Step 3: Display paging information in the view file.
Obtain pagination information through the paginate()
method, which returns a string in the form of a paginator with buttons for previous page, next page, etc. We print the returned string directly in the view file to display the paging content.
// 分页 echo $list->render();
Specific code and examples:
Controller code example:
public function index() { $page = input('page') ?: 1; //获取页码数,默认为第一页 $limit = 10; //每页显示记录数 $start = ($page - 1) * $limit; //起始记录索引,例如:第一页 $start=0,第二页 $start=10... $list = Db::name('user')->limit($start, $limit)->select(); $count = Db::name('user')->count(); // 获取总记录数 $this->assign([ 'list' => $list, 'count' => $count, 'limit' => $limit ]); return $this->fetch(); }
View code example:
// 渲染表格// 分页 echo $list->render();
The above code implements a simple paging function , the paging function can be easily realized through the paginate method of TP. I believe it can be used with ease in your actual development.
